Near Collisions in the RC4 Stream Cipher

Anindya Shankar Bhandari

Abstract

In this paper we explore the intriguing factors involved in the non one-one nature of the RC4, and explore new techniques and present interesting findings regarding the same. The first part of this paper studies near colliding keys of the RC4, and discusses how these keys are localized into clusters in the key-space. The second part of this paper proposes a new collision search algorithm specifically for 16-byte keys. It is generally the practice to choose the byte that differs between two keys to be near the end of the key. However, this is not necessary for 16-byte keys, and the second part of this paper discusses how this may be used to grant us an additional degree of control.
